The National Sea Rescue Institute (NSRI) in South Africa is recognizing women volunteers this August. Women make up 28% of NSRI volunteers, contributing significantly to sea rescues, drowning prevention, and water safety education. Carmen Long and Nicky Whitehead are highlighted for their leadership roles. Long is one of the first women appointed as a Class 1 Coxswain, while Whitehead serves as a Station Commander. Both emphasize the rewarding nature of their roles despite personal sacrifices.
